Can I define somehow within MS environment or do I need a 3:third party software? I know this is not R:Base but it is needed to support R:Base >> You do not need a third party program. What you need to do is use the /CONSOLE option on the remote desktop program. In order to do this, you need to create a desktop shortcut (on your desktop) to the user's machine, like this: %SystemRoot%\system32\mstsc.exe 123.45.67.8 /CONSOLE (assuming your user is on IP 123.45.67.8). When you run this shortcut, you will be connected not to a mysterious "internal" session on the remote computer, but to the actual session that the user can see. When you log in, you must use the same credentials as the user logged in at the workstation. Hope this helps! -- Larry
